Exploring the Unique Natural Archways: Marks & Dukes Window and Smugglers Cave

Private Boat Charter Comino, Blue Lagoon, Crystal Lagoon, Gozo - Exploring the Unique Natural Archways: Marks & Dukes Window and Smugglers Cave

After leaving Sliema, the boat moves toward Marks & Dukes Window, iconic rock formations that are easily seen from the water. The tour then makes a 45-minute stop at Smugglers Cave, where guests can enter the cave to get close-up views of the natural rock formations.

This part of the trip highlights Malta’s rugged coastline and caves, with clear waters perfect for photos. The Smugglers Cave stop provides a rare chance to be inside these formations, which large tour boats often cannot access due to size restrictions.

Exploring Gozo’s Coastline: Beaches and Bays

The Gozo & Comino tour option includes a two-hour visit to Gozo Island, where the boat takes travelers along the coast. Stops at Ramla Bay, San Blas Bay, or Mgarr ix-Xini in Gozo provide swimming, snorkeling, and coastal exploration opportunities.

Guests have the chance to disembark at these beaches or bays to sunbathe or explore further. The coastline features beautiful sandy beaches and rocky coves, making it an excellent addition for those wishing to see another island and enjoy a more diverse landscape.
